测试三角形的测试用例
在三角形计算中,要求三角型的三个边长:A、B 和C。当三边不可能构成三角形时提示错误,可构成三角形时计算三角形周长。若是等腰三角形打印“等腰三角形”,若是等边三角形,则提示“等
边三角形”。画出程序流程图、控制流程图、计算圈复杂度V(g),找出基本测试路径 画出程序流程图、控制流程图、计算圈复杂度V(g),找出基本测试路径
这是用例么? 这明明是大学时见过的一道C语言的编程题 不是测试用例
我也是新手 整了半天出来的 欢迎给点建议
三角形测试问题描述:
程序可用的数据类型是浮点型,通过对同一个三角形三条边的长度的读入,程序根据这三个值判断三角形属于不等边,等腰,直角,等腰直角,等边三角形中的哪一种?
综合使用边界值分析.等价类划分和错误推断等技术,可以设计出下列测试的情况:
(1) 正常的不等边三角形
(2) 正常的等边三角形
(3) 正常的等腰三角形,包括两条相等的边的三种不同的排列方法
(4) 正常的直角三角形
(5) 正常等腰直角三角形,包括两边相等的三种不同的排列方法
(6) 退化的三角形(即,两边之和等于第三边),包括三种不同的排列方法
(7) 三条边不能构成三角形(两边之和小于第三边),包括三种排列方法
(8) 一条边长度为零,两条边为零,三边为零的9种排列方法
(9) 输入数据包含负数
(10) 输入数据不全(只知道2边的长度不知道第三边)
(11) 输入的数据不符合程序规定的数据类型.
下表为程序测试的数据:
测试功能 测试数据
a b c
1. 等边
2. 等腰
3. 不等边
4. 直角
5. 等腰直角
6. 非三角形
7. 零数据
8. 退化情况
9. 负数据
10. 遗漏数据
11. 无效输入
8,8,8
8,10,8
8,10,12
6,8,10
8,8√2,8
4,4,9
0,0,0
0,0,8
O,8,8
8,4,4
-10,-9,-8
-10,-9,8
-10,9,8
–,–,–,
–,–,10,
–,10,10,
+,=,*
7A,8.5,B
A,B,C
8,10,A –,–,–,
10,8,8
8,12,10
8,10,6
8,,8,8√2
4,9,4
–,–,–,
0,8,0
8,0,8
4,8,4
-9,-10,-8
-9,-10,8
9,-10,8
–,–,–,
–,10,–,
10,10,–,
+,*,=
8.5,7A, B
B,A,C
A,10,8 –,–,–
8,8,10
12,10,8
10,8,6
8√2,8,,8
9,4,4
–,–,–,
8,0,0
8,8,0
8,4,4
-8,-9,-10
8,-9,-10
8,9,-10
–,–,–,
10,–,–,
10,–,10,
*,+,=
7A, B,8.5
C,A,B
10,8,A
测试数据覆盖程度检验表
编号 测试数据 覆盖的边
1.
2a
2b
2c
3a
3b
3c
4a
4b
4c
5a
5b
5c
6a
6b
6c 8,8,8
8,10,8
10,8,8
8,8,10
8,10,12
8,12,10
12,10,8
6,8,10
8,10,6
10,8,6
8,8√2,8
8,,8,8√2
8√2,8,,8
4,4,9
4,9,4
9,4,4
1,2,3,4,5,6,7,8
1,2,3,4,14,16,17,19,20,21,22,8
1,2,3,4,14,18,19,20,21,22,8
1,2,3,4,5,15,19,20,21,22,8
1,2,3,4,14,16,27,28,29,30,31,8
1,2,3,4,14,16,27,28,29,30,31,8
1,2,3,4,14,16,27,28,29,30,31,8
1,2,3,4,14,16,27,28,29,34,35,8
1,2,3,4,14,16,27,28,33,35,8
1,2,3,4,14,16,27,32,35,8
1,2,3,4,14,16,17,19,24,26,8
1,2,3,4,5,15,19,20,25,26,8
1,2,3,4,14,18,23,26,8
1,2,3,11,12,13,8
1,2,10,12,13,8
1,9,12,13,8 ...好象发上来格式不对了 你自己调下 还有那个测试流程图也没发上来 要的留邮箱
我发给你们 iris_zhang2004@sina.com
:)
谢谢啦,偶要的 我也要 谢谢了
sh_jb211@nou.com.cn
我很想要份,谢谢
我很想要份,谢谢longfengwu520@126.com 也给我发个谢谢啊: )
mangke0427@hotmail.com 好像整理的还满齐的,也给我发份吧,谢谢。
diyutiantang1969@sian.com 麻烦也发给我一下呀,谢谢哟!
aifly@aifly.cn 俺也需要一份 谢谢了
zgzgwg@163.com 谢谢,sunyjht@163.com 麻烦你给我发一下,谢谢
liuyu2288@126.com 偶也要
zhoushan68@sohu.com
谢谢拉 复杂度=流程图中有两个分支的节点的数目+1
复杂度是几就建几条用例 谢谢啦,我也可以要一份吗?
hjlfmyl620@yahoo.com.cn 帮忙发一份了,谢了。
yuzaixiu@126.com sdlkfj4sdlkfj1